Timezone in Melíssi

Melíssi is located in the Europe/Athens timezone, with a standard UTC offset of +2 hours. During daylight saving time, which begins on the last Sunday in March and ends on the last Sunday in October, the offset changes to UTC +3 hours. This means that for about half of the year, clocks in Melíssi are set forward by one hour to take advantage of longer daylight hours.
